In this program, we have asked the listeners of Fardaa Station about their observations regarding the increase in prices of various items in recent months. We discuss issues and news such as John Bolton's remarks in Israel about Iran, the latest developments in the conflict between the Afghan government and the Taliban, the strategic loss of Iran's U-23 football team to Myanmar, and the latest results and medals from the Asian Games in Indonesia. Throughout the program, we humorously address topics and news such as the rise in airplane ticket prices and the IELTS exam, threats to football spectators by the Minister of Interior, the controversies surrounding an event held in Feyziyeh, and this week's statements by Hassan Rouhani.
